一种利用双眼摄像模组采集处理输出3d图像的方法

文档序号:9330942阅读:204来源:国知局
一种利用双眼摄像模组采集处理输出3d图像的方法
【技术领域】
[0001]本发明涉及一种采集处理输出3D图像的方法,尤其是涉及一种利用双眼摄像模组获取并处理合成3D图像的方法,属于摄像技术领域。
【背景技术】
[0002]近年来伴随着智能手机、平板的市场成长摄像头模组也获得了高速的发展,市场对摄像头功能和技术的要求也越来越高,基于传统2D的技术应用,如像素升级、低照度、宽动态技术已遇到一定的发展瓶颈,越发难以满足手机、平板等终端的发展和市场客户的需求;
为此,有公司研发了相应3D图像采集处理模组,如中国专利ZL201410331431.6公开的“一种基于双目视觉的图像采集与伪3D显示系统”,但是其算法复杂,加重了手机等处理单元的负荷,且处理效果较差,市场应用前景不高。

【发明内容】

[0003]本发明的目的在于克服上述不足,提供一种算法简单且对处理需求较低利用双眼摄像模组采集处理输出3D图像的方法。
[0004]本发明的目的是这样实现的:
一种利用双眼摄像模组采集处理输出3D图像的方法,
所述方法包含有以下步骤:
步骤1、通过左右两个摄像头获取两组图像信息;
步骤2、上述步骤I中获得的两组图像信息数字化转换成RAWlO码流后通过MIPI总线传输到处理单元;
步骤3、处理单元在接收MIPI总线传输过来的图像信息数字化码流时,分别撷取两组奇数列数据和偶数列数据;即撷取一个摄像头获取的图像信息数字化码流的奇数列数据,撷取另一个摄像头获取的图像信息数字化码流的偶数列数据;
步骤4、处理单元将获取的两个摄像头的奇列数数据和偶数列数据完整的拼合成一 3D图像数据,并将该3D图像数据通过MIPI总线传输至显示单元。
[0005]本发明一种利用双眼摄像模组采集处理输出3D图像的方法,两个摄像头之间的光学中心间距为20~35mm。
[0006]本发明一种利用双眼摄像模组采集处理输出3D图像的方法,两个摄像头之间的光学中心间距为28mm,且两个摄像头的三轴位置偏移控制在±0.1mm内,两个摄像头的倾斜角控制在±1°内。
[0007]本发明一种利用双眼摄像模组采集处理输出3D图像的方法,所述步骤还包含有步骤5,显示单元上贴附有光栅镀膜以实现3D图像的观看。
[0008]本发明一种利用双眼摄像模组采集处理输出3D图像的方法,所述步骤还包含有步骤5,观看者通过佩戴3D光栅眼镜以实现3D图像的观看。
[0009]与现有技术相比,本发明的有益效果是:
本发明通过处理单元同时获取两个摄像头数据,通过MIPI数据格式计算出各像素的点位置,撷取一摄像头的奇数列做为后期图像的左半画幅,撷取另一摄像头的偶数列作为后期图像的右半画幅,最终合成3D效果的数据图像,因此3D合成算法简单高效;且图像处理单元输出仍为标准的单个MIPI总线RAWlO码流,不会增加手机平台侧的资源负荷,不会影响手机性能,从而实现了流畅的3D采集获取。
【附图说明】
[0010]图1为本发明一种利用双眼摄像模组采集处理输出3D图像的方法的原理框图。
[0011]图2为本发明一种利用双眼摄像模组采集处理输出3D图像的方法中所用的MIPI总线传输的数据格式。
[0012]图3为本发明一种利用双眼摄像模组采集处理输出3D图像的方法中所用的双眼摄像模组的电路原理图。
[0013]图3-A为图3的A处局部放大图。
[0014]图3-B为图3的B处局部放大图。
[0015]图3-C为图3的C处局部放大图。
[0016]图3-D为图3的D处局部放大图。
[0017]图3-E为图3的E处局部放大图。
【具体实施方式】
[0018]参见图1~3,本发明涉及的一种利用双眼摄像模组采集处理输出3D图像的方法,所述方法包含有以下步骤:
步骤1、通过左右两个摄像头获取两组图像信息,且两个摄像头之间的光学中心间距为20~35臟,优选的,采用28mm的中心间距,且两个摄像头的三轴位置偏移控制在±0.1mm内,两个摄像头的倾斜角控制在±1°内;
步骤2、上述步骤I中获得的两组图像信息数字化转换成RAWlO码流后通过MIPI总线传输到处理单元;
步骤3、处理单元在接收MIPI总线传输过来的图像信息数字化码流时,分别撷取两组奇数列数据和偶数列数据;即撷取一个摄像头获取的图像信息数字化码流的奇数列数据,撷取另一个摄像头获取的图像信息数字化码流的偶数列数据;
步骤4、处理单元将获取的两个摄像头的奇列数数据和偶数列数据完整的拼合成一 3D图像数据,并将该3D图像数据通过MIPI总线传输至显示单元;
步骤5、显示单元上贴附有光栅镀膜以实现3D图像的观看,或者通过佩戴3D光栅眼镜以实现观看。
[0019]针对图1~3再做具体说明:
图像采集时,A、B摄像头同时通过VCM对焦获取清晰的图像画面,图像信息数字化后通过MIPI总线输出RAWlO码流给到3D图像处理单元;通过对MIPI总线数据格式的分析可计算出图像各像素点在MIPI总线数据流中的位置,图像处理单元根据计算值抽取A摄像头图像数据的奇数列(1、3、5、7、……、2447)作为新成像的左半幅画面,抽取B摄像头图像数据的偶数列(2、4、6、8、……、2448)作为新成像的右半幅画面,左右半幅合成一副完整的3D图像,再通过MIPI总线接口给到手机、平板平台。手机应用时可通过3D光栅眼镜或者手机屏光栅镀膜实现3D图像观看;
另外:需要注意的是,上述【具体实施方式】仅为本专利的一个优化方案,本领域的技术人员根据上述构思所做的任何改动或改进,均在本专利的保护范围之内。
【主权项】
1.一种利用双眼摄像模组采集处理输出3D图像的方法,其特征在于: 所述方法包含有以下步骤: 步骤1、通过左右两个摄像头获取两组图像信息; 步骤2、上述步骤I中获得的两组图像信息数字化转换成RAWlO码流后通过MIPI总线传输到处理单元; 步骤3、处理单元在接收MIPI总线传输过来的图像信息数字化码流时,分别撷取两组奇数列数据和偶数列数据;即撷取一个摄像头获取的图像信息数字化码流的奇数列数据,撷取另一个摄像头获取的图像信息数字化码流的偶数列数据; 步骤4、处理单元将获取的两个摄像头的奇列数数据和偶数列数据完整的拼合成一 3D图像数据,并将该3D图像数据通过MIPI总线传输至显示单元。2.如权利要求1所述一种利用双眼摄像模组采集处理输出3D图像的方法,其特征在于:两个摄像头之间的光学中心间距为20~35mm。3.如权利要求2所述一种利用双眼摄像模组采集处理输出3D图像的方法,其特征在于:两个摄像头之间的光学中心间距为28mm,且两个摄像头的三轴位置偏移控制在±0.1mm内,两个摄像头的倾斜角控制在±1°内。4.如权利要求1、2或3所述一种利用双眼摄像模组采集处理输出3D图像的方法,其特征在于:所述步骤还包含有步骤5,显示单元上贴附有光栅镀膜以实现3D图像的观看。5.如权利要求1、2或3所述一种利用双眼摄像模组采集处理输出3D图像的方法,其特征在于:所述步骤还包含有步骤5,观看者通过佩戴3D光栅眼镜以实现3D图像的观看。
【专利摘要】本发明一种利用双眼摄像模组采集处理输出3D图像的方法,步骤1、通过左右两个摄像头获取两组图像信息;步骤2、上述步骤1中获得的两组图像信息数字化转换成RAW10码流后通过MIPI总线传输到处理单元;步骤3、处理单元在接收MIPI总线传输过来的图像信息数字化码流时,分别撷取两组奇数列数据和偶数列数据;步骤4、处理单元将获取的两个摄像头的奇列数数据和偶数列数据完整的拼合成一3D图像数据,并将该3D图像数据通过MIPI总线传输至显示单元。本发明一种利用双眼摄像模组采集处理输出3D图像的方法,算法简单且对处理需求较。
【IPC分类】H04N13/00, H04N13/02
【公开号】CN105049823
【申请号】CN201410806139
【发明人】邬建勇
【申请人】江阴新晟电子有限公司
【公开日】2015年11月11日
【申请日】2014年12月23日
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1